Logged in, the buddies showed up in the list, so far so good. Double clicked on one, started typing and empathy died, the telepathy processes were still alive. Happens exactly when I type a space after a word, doesn't matter what keyboard layout I'm using, doesn't mater which protocol is being used (well I tried both gtalk and yahoo). Tested it on the desktop as well, but both computers are pretty identical, they even have mostly the same packages installed.
